> yep, just use Query Analyser.... the Enterprise Manager is 
> good for some things, but its not suited for all!
> 
> so if you want to shrink a log named FOO to 5 MB, then just use
> 
> dbcc shrinkfile (foo,5)
> 
> then press F5

> run either a shrinkdb or a shrinkfile dbcc command : 
> 
> dbcc shrinkdatabase ([database],[percentage of free space])
> 
> dbcc shrinkfile ([transactionlog], [sizeyouwant])
> 
> You may be to terminate all active pid's to run these 
> commands (start/stop server should do it)

> Is anyone here good with SQL Server admin?
> 
> We have a transaction log which has grown way too large and 
> won't shrink. We're tried backing up and restoring and still 
> won't shrink. Trying to stop it before it consumes the whole 
> hard drive...it seems to have an enormous amount of unused 
> space which it won't release. Anyone any ideas on how to 
> shrink this - or point me to a SQL group.
